    On my way to the American Adventurist SoCal Mountain Rendezvous I had to stop by the FrontRunner Outfitters new shop and do some shopping :D

    I replaced the Thule bars on the trailer with a SlimLine2 rack and also picked up one for my ARE canopy to match the truck.

    [​IMG]

    Posted up at the event. Seriously such a great time with some awesome people!
    Let's get more Tacoma's out there next year :D

    A couple photographs of these awesome new Toyo Open Country R/T's.

    After almost 2 months of daily driving and some light trails (dirt, rain, mud, rocks etc) I feel like these will be my go-to tires for a long time.

    I still need to test them out aired down doing some crawling.

    I will be working on a full detailed review for those interested also.
